Abstract(in English) | In this paper, we evaluate influence of a prediction horizon with combinatorial approach of the model predictive control (MPC) of dc-dc converters. In generally, responsiveness and stability of the model predictive control are affected by the prediction horizon. In addition, one of the problems of DC-DC converters using model predictive control is heavy computation burden. First, we propose a reduction of computation burden method that considers control and switching periods. Next, the characteristics when the influence of prediction horizon are evaluated using a step-down DC-DC converter in simulation study. |
